About the role

The Senior Underwriter is accountable for risk evaluation and underwriting for new deals and existing transactions, ensuring that all decisions are consistent with the company’s risk appetite, underwriting guidelines, and governance standards. This includes detailed analysis of individual counter parties and risk portfolios across comprehensive multi‑buyer programmes, select risk pools, and single obligor solutions. The role also requires building and maintaining strong relationships with insurers, brokers, clients, and internal stakeholders to support disciplined underwriting outcomes.

Alongside core risk underwriting responsibilities, the role provides scope to contribute to wider business initiatives. These include leading renewal reviews and execution, supporting product development, and contributing to cross‑functional projects that strengthen efficiency, governance, and risk management standards. While secondary to risk underwriting responsibilities, these projects are an important part of ensuring the business continues to evolve and scale effectively.

The Senior Underwriter will be required to collaborate closely with colleagues across commercial, product, operations, technology, and marketing business segments, ensuring that underwriting decisions safeguard the company’s risk position while also supporting a consistent and positive client experience.

This role holds a dual reporting line, reporting directly to the Group VP of Risk Underwriting and Managing Director of the Americas.

Responsibilities
  • Underwriting
    • Independently analyse and underwrite new and on‑boarded risks, working closely with underwriting colleagues and the leadership team.
    • Monitor the portfolio to identify emerging risks, ensure adherence to risk appetite, and recommend appropriate actions.
    • Provide analysis and commentary on emerging data trends within the risk portfolio.
    • Track and report key underwriting portfolio metrics and performance indicators to the Group VP of Risk Underwriting.
    • Present transactions to the Underwriting Committee.
    • Embed key insights from reviews, audits, and retrospective appraisals into underwriting processes to strengthen discipline and drive continuous improvement.
  • Cross‑Functional Support
    • Provide underwriting expertise to cross‑functional initiatives, including product innovation and technology platform design, ensuring risk considerations are embedded into business improvements.
    • Contribute feedback and recommendations to the product manager and engineering team.
    • Support business priorities such as data quality improvements or workflow refinements, in coordination with the Group VP of Risk Underwriting, where these align with underwriting objectives.
Key attributes
  • Skills and experience
    • Minimum 5 years’ experience in risk underwriting, ideally within the trade credit insurance market.
    • Excellent communication and drafting skills; capable of producing compelling analysis papers and justifications for capacity providers.
    • Confident working with international jurisdictions and understanding varying credit risk and legal environments.
  • Desirable Attributes
    • Understanding of policy structures, contract wordings, commercial underwriting, and legal/contractual considerations in credit risk analysis.
    • Comfortable handling ambiguity and complexity in both deal structures and risk profiles.
    • Strong attention to detail and a commitment to improving efficiency and quality in underwriting practices.
    • Ability and experience of working across international markets and multiple trade sectors, applying risk expertise to different industries and jurisdictions.
    • Collaborative mindset with a proactive approach to supporting cross‑functional initiatives.
